Description

4-[10-(4-Aminophenyl)Anthracen-9-Yl]Aniline is a high-purity, functionalized anthracene derivative featuring two primary amine groups. This compound matters as a critical organic building block and photoactive intermediate for advanced material synthesis. It is primarily needed by R&D and production teams in the organic electronics, pharmaceutical, and specialty chemical sectors.

Application

  • Organic Light-Emitting Diode (OLED) Materials: Serves as a core precursor for electron-transporting or host materials in display and lighting technologies.
  • Pharmaceutical Intermediate: Used in the synthesis of complex molecules for drug discovery and development programs.
  • Polymer and Dye Synthesis: Acts as a monomer or functionalizing agent for creating conjugated polymers, fluorescent dyes, and pigments.
  • Research & Development: Employed in academic and industrial labs for studying charge transport, photophysical properties, and novel organic reactions.
  • Chemical Sensors: Utilized in the development of fluorescence-based sensing platforms due to its anthracene backbone.
  • Liquid Crystal and Advanced Material Components: Incorporated into the design of functional materials requiring rigid, planar aromatic structures with reactive handles.

Basic Information

Product Name 4-[10-(4-Aminophenyl)Anthracen-9-Yl]Aniline
CAS No. 106704-35-2
Molecular Formula C26H20N2
Molecular Weight 360.45 g/mol
Synonyms 9,10-Bis(4-aminophenyl)anthracene; 4,4'-(Anthracene-9,10-diyl)dianiline; 9,10-Di(4-aminophenyl)anthracene; 4-[10-(4-Aminophenyl)-9-anthryl]aniline; 4,4'-(9,10-Anthracenediyl)bis[benzenamine]; 9,10-Bis(p-aminophenyl)anthracene; BAPA; 4,4'-(Anthracene-9,10-diyl)bis(aniline)

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at room temperature (15-25°C) under an inert atmosphere (e.g., nitrogen or argon) to prevent oxidation. Keep away from strong oxidizing agents.
